Ignore:
Timestamp:
Aug 23, 2017, 9:27:43 AM (7 years ago)
Author:
coas-nagasima
Message:

文字コードを設定

File:
1 edited

Legend:

Unmodified
Added
Removed
  • EcnlProtoTool/trunk/asp3_dcre/arch/arm_gcc/common/sp804.h

    • Property svn:keywords deleted
    • Property svn:mime-type changed from text/x-chdr to text/x-chdr;charset=UTF-8
    r270 r321  
    66 *              Graduate School of Information Science, Nagoya Univ., JAPAN
    77 *
    8  *  上記著作権è€
    9 ã¯ï¼Œä»¥ä¸‹ã®(1)~(4)の条件を満たす場合に限り,本ソフトウェ
    10  *  ア(本ソフトウェアを改変したものを含む.以下同じ)を使用・複製・改
    11  *  変・再é
    12 å¸ƒï¼ˆä»¥ä¸‹ï¼Œåˆ©ç”¨ã¨å‘¼ã¶ï¼‰ã™ã‚‹ã“とを無償で許諾する.
    13  *  (1) 本ソフトウェアをソースコードの形で利用する場合には,上記の著作
    14  *      権表示,この利用条件および下記の無保証規定が,そのままの形でソー
    15  *      スコード中に含まれていること.
    16  *  (2) 本ソフトウェアを,ライブラリ形式など,他のソフトウェア開発に使
    17  *      用できる形で再é
    18 å¸ƒã™ã‚‹å ´åˆã«ã¯ï¼Œå†é
    19 å¸ƒã«ä¼´ã†ãƒ‰ã‚­ãƒ¥ãƒ¡ãƒ³ãƒˆï¼ˆåˆ©ç”¨
    20  *      è€
    21 ãƒžãƒ‹ãƒ¥ã‚¢ãƒ«ãªã©ï¼‰ã«ï¼Œä¸Šè¨˜ã®è‘—作権表示,この利用条件および下記
    22  *      の無保証規定を掲載すること.
    23  *  (3) 本ソフトウェアを,機器に組み込むなど,他のソフトウェア開発に使
    24  *      用できない形で再é
    25 å¸ƒã™ã‚‹å ´åˆã«ã¯ï¼Œæ¬¡ã®ã„ずれかの条件を満たすこ
    26  *      と.
    27  *    (a) 再é
    28 å¸ƒã«ä¼´ã†ãƒ‰ã‚­ãƒ¥ãƒ¡ãƒ³ãƒˆï¼ˆåˆ©ç”¨è€
    29 ãƒžãƒ‹ãƒ¥ã‚¢ãƒ«ãªã©ï¼‰ã«ï¼Œä¸Šè¨˜ã®è‘—
    30  *        作権表示,この利用条件および下記の無保証規定を掲載すること.
    31  *    (b) 再é
    32 å¸ƒã®å½¢æ
    33 ‹ã‚’,別に定める方法によって,TOPPERSプロジェクトに
    34  *        報告すること.
    35  *  (4) 本ソフトウェアの利用により直接的または間接的に生じるいかなる損
    36  *      害からも,上記著作権è€
    37 ãŠã‚ˆã³TOPPERSプロジェクトをå
    38 è²¬ã™ã‚‹ã“と.
    39  *      また,本ソフトウェアのユーザまたはエンドユーザからのいかなる理
    40  *      由に基づく請求からも,上記著作権è€
    41 ãŠã‚ˆã³TOPPERSプロジェクトを
    42  *      å
    43 è²¬ã™ã‚‹ã“と.
     8 *  上記著作権者は,以下の(1)~(4)の条件を満たす場合に限り,本ソフトウェ
     9 *  ア(本ソフトウェアを改変したものを含む.以下同じ)を使用・複製・改
     10 *  変・再配布(以下,利用と呼ぶ)することを無償で許諾する.
     11 *  (1) 本ソフトウェアをソースコードの形で利用する場合には,上記の著作
     12 *      権表示,この利用条件および下記の無保証規定が,そのままの形でソー
     13 *      スコード中に含まれていること.
     14 *  (2) 本ソフトウェアを,ライブラリ形式など,他のソフトウェア開発に使
     15 *      用できる形で再配布する場合には,再配布に伴うドキュメント(利用
     16 *      者マニュアルなど)に,上記の著作権表示,この利用条件および下記
     17 *      の無保証規定を掲載すること.
     18 *  (3) 本ソフトウェアを,機器に組み込むなど,他のソフトウェア開発に使
     19 *      用できない形で再配布する場合には,次のいずれかの条件を満たすこ
     20 *      と.
     21 *    (a) 再配布に伴うドキュメント(利用者マニュアルなど)に,上記の著
     22 *        作権表示,この利用条件および下記の無保証規定を掲載すること.
     23 *    (b) 再配布の形態を,別に定める方法によって,TOPPERSプロジェクトに
     24 *        報告すること.
     25 *  (4) 本ソフトウェアの利用により直接的または間接的に生じるいかなる損
     26 *      害からも,上記著作権者およびTOPPERSプロジェクトを免責すること.
     27 *      また,本ソフトウェアのユーザまたはエンドユーザからのいかなる理
     28 *      由に基づく請求からも,上記著作権者およびTOPPERSプロジェクトを
     29 *      免責すること.
    4430 *
    45  *  本ソフトウェアは,無保証で提供されているものである.上記著作権è€
    46 ãŠ
    47  *  よびTOPPERSプロジェクトは,本ソフトウェアに関して,特定の使用目的
    48  *  に対する適合性も含めて,いかなる保証も行わない.また,本ソフトウェ
    49  *  アの利用により直接的または間接的に生じたいかなる損害に関しても,そ
    50  *  の責任を負わない.
     31 *  本ソフトウェアは,無保証で提供されているものである.上記著作権者お
     32 *  よびTOPPERSプロジェクトは,本ソフトウェアに関して,特定の使用目的
     33 *  に対する適合性も含めて,いかなる保証も行わない.また,本ソフトウェ
     34 *  アの利用により直接的または間接的に生じたいかなる損害に関しても,そ
     35 *  の責任を負わない.
    5136 *
    5237 *  $Id$
     
    5439
    5540/*
    56  *              ARM Dual-Timer Module(SP804)に関する定義
     41 *              ARM Dual-Timer Module(SP804)に関する定義
    5742 */
    5843
     
    6146
    6247/*
    63  *  タイマレジスタの番地の定義
     48 *  タイマレジスタの番地の定義
    6449 */
    6550#define SP804_LR(base)          ((uint32_t *)((base) + 0x00U))
     
    7257
    7358/*
    74  *  制御レジスタ(SP804_CR)の設定値
     59 *  制御レジスタ(SP804_CR)の設定値
    7560 */
    76 #define SP804_DISABLE                   UINT_C(0x00)    /* タイマディスエーブル */
    77 #define SP804_ENABLE                    UINT_C(0x80)    /* タイマイネーブル */
    78 #define SP804_INT_ENABLE                UINT_C(0x20)    /* タイマ割込みイネーブル */
    79 #define SP804_MODE_FREERUN              UINT_C(0x00)    /* フリーランニングモード */
    80 #define SP804_MODE_PERIODIC             UINT_C(0x40)    /* 周期モード */
    81 #define SP804_MODE_ONESHOT              UINT_C(0x01)    /* ワンショットモード */
    82 #define SP804_SIZE_32                   UINT_C(0x02)    /* 32ビット */
    83 #define SP804_PRESCALE_1                UINT_C(0x00)    /* プリスケーラ ×1 */
    84 #define SP804_PRESCALE_16               UINT_C(0x04)    /* プリスケーラ ×16 */
    85 #define SP804_PRESCALE_256              UINT_C(0x08)    /* プリスケーラ ×256 */
     61#define SP804_DISABLE                   UINT_C(0x00)    /* タイマディスエーブル */
     62#define SP804_ENABLE                    UINT_C(0x80)    /* タイマイネーブル */
     63#define SP804_INT_ENABLE                UINT_C(0x20)    /* タイマ割込みイネーブル */
     64#define SP804_MODE_FREERUN              UINT_C(0x00)    /* フリーランニングモード */
     65#define SP804_MODE_PERIODIC             UINT_C(0x40)    /* 周期モード */
     66#define SP804_MODE_ONESHOT              UINT_C(0x01)    /* ワンショットモード */
     67#define SP804_SIZE_32                   UINT_C(0x02)    /* 32ビット */
     68#define SP804_PRESCALE_1                UINT_C(0x00)    /* プリスケーラ ×1 */
     69#define SP804_PRESCALE_16               UINT_C(0x04)    /* プリスケーラ ×16 */
     70#define SP804_PRESCALE_256              UINT_C(0x08)    /* プリスケーラ ×256 */
    8671
    8772#endif /* TOPPERS_SP804_H */
Note: See TracChangeset for help on using the changeset viewer.